The zlib module in python is used to compress or decompress data for saving and transmission. It is the basis for other compression tools. Let's take a look at how Python uses the zlib module to compress and decompress strings and files. Without further ado, let’s look directly at the sample code.
Example 1: Compressing and decompressing strings

import zlib
message = 'abcd1234'
compressed = zlib.compress(message)
decompressed = zlib.decompress(compressed)
print 'original:', repr(message)
print 'compressed:', repr(compressed)
print 'decompressed:', repr(decompressed)


Result

original: 'abcd1234'
compressed: 'x\x9cKLJN1426\x01\x00\x0b\xf8\x02U'
decompressed: 'abcd1234'


Example 2: Compressed and decompressed files

import zlib
def compress(infile, dst, level=9):
 infile = open(infile, 'rb')
 dst = open(dst, 'wb')
 compress = zlib.compressobj(level)
 data = infile.read(1024)
 while data:
  dst.write(compress.compress(data))
  data = infile.read(1024)
 dst.write(compress.flush())
def decompress(infile, dst):
 infile = open(infile, 'rb')
 dst = open(dst, 'wb')
 decompress = zlib.decompressobj()
 data = infile.read(1024)
 while data:
  dst.write(decompress.decompress(data))
  data = infile.read(1024)
 dst.write(decompress.flush())
if __name__ == "__main__":
 compress('in.txt', 'out.txt')
 decompress('out.txt', 'out_decompress.txt')


Result
Generated file

out_decompress.txt out.txt


Problem - Processing object too large exception

>>> import zlib
>>> a = '123'
>>> b = zlib.compress(a)
>>> b
'x\x9c342\x06\x00\x01-\x00\x97'
>>> a = 'a' * 1024 * 1024 * 1024 * 10
>>> b = zlib.compress(a)
Traceback (most recent call last):
 File "", line 1, in 
OverflowError: size does not fit in an int
